This bill mandates that fire departments in South Dakota can only purchase firefighting personal protective equipment that includes a permanently affixed label indicating the presence of perfluoroalkyl or polyfluoroalkyl substances. The term "firefighting personal protective equipment" encompasses various items such as coats, coveralls, footwear, gloves, helmets, hoods, trousers, and any other clothing intended for use by firefighting personnel during fire and rescue operations.

Additionally, the bill specifies that it will take effect on July 1, 2026. This legislation aims to enhance safety and transparency regarding the materials used in firefighting gear, ensuring that personnel are informed about potentially harmful substances in their equipment.
